Venice Beach is a quieter unit of Half Moon Bay State Beach with a group campground nearby, distinct from the far more famous Venice Beach in Los Angeles despite sharing a name. It's a straightforward, low key stretch of the same connected Half Moon Bay sand.

Local Tip

Double check you've got the right Venice Beach if you're searching online, this one is a much quieter Half Moon Bay state beach unit, not the Los Angeles boardwalk scene.

Parking

A day use fee applies; the exact amount is best confirmed at the entrance.

Accessibility

A path leads from parking down to the beach.

Pets

Dogs are not allowed on the sand at Venice Beach, part of Half Moon Bay State Beach, though leashed dogs can use the Coastside Trail.

Weather & the best time to visit

Fog is common most mornings year round, typical of the Half Moon Bay area.
